Four friends own a car wash. The total profit in the first month was $438. In two months, each of the friends had made a profit

of $184. They always divide the profits equally. How much profit did the car wash make in the second month?

Answer:$ 298

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

Total Profit in first month is $ 438

It is also given that in two months they each had a profit $ 184

Total Profit in 2 months =184\times 4=$ 736

so in second month Profit =736-438=$ 298

A total of   $ 298 profit is earned in second month.

Answer:

$298

Step-by-step explanation:

So in order to solve this we first have to calculate how much have they done in total in these two months, and we do that by multiplying 184 by 4:

184*4=736

Now from the total we will withdraw the amount of money that they did in the first month:

736-438=298

So now we know that they made 298 dollars in the second month.
